Well, being a colorado resident I'd say you should come out here, sometimes my family and I go up to estes park and from there you can go into rocky mountain national park, and if you come in the right time of year (which i cant remember but some easy research would work) you can see the elk in estes park, literall elk standing on the side of the streets, thousands. And from what i remember, its not too expensive either.
